Carrot Argonaute1 (C-Ago1) was isolated from a subtractive cDNA library to obtain somatic embryogenesis related genes. C-Ago1 has three conserved domains, which are found in all other Argonautes. C-Ago1 has specific expression during somatic embryogenesis, which indicates that microRNA gene expression controlling system is required for somatic embryogenesis.

Somatic embryogenesis is a unique process in plant cells. For example, embryogenic cells (EC) of carrot (Daucus carota) maintained in a medium containing 2,4-dichlorophenoxyacetic acid (2,4-D) regenerate whole plants via somatic embryogenesis after the depletion of 2,4-D. Although some genes such as C-ABI3 and C-LEC1 have been found to be involved in somatic embryogenesis, the critical molecular and cellular mechanisms for somatic embryogenesis are unknown. To characterize the early mechanism in the induction of somatic embryogenesis, we isolated genes expressed during the early stage of somatic embryogenesis after 2,4-D depletion. Subtractive hybridization screening and subsequent RNA gel blot analysis suggested a candidate gene, Carrot Early Somatic Embryogenesis 1 (C-ESE1). C-ESE1 encodes a protein that has agglutinin and S-locus-glycoprotein domains and its expression is highly specific to primordial cells of somatic embryo. Transgenic carrot cells with reduced expression of C-ESE1 had wide intercellular space and decreased polysaccharides on the cell surface and showed delayed development in somatic embryogenesis. The importance of cell-to-cell attachment in somatic embryogenesis is discussed.

The Arabidopsis thaliana LEC1 gene regulates embryo morphology and seed maturation. For a better understanding of its function, we isolated a carrot (Daucus carota L. cv. US-Harumakigosun) counterpart of this gene, C-LEC1, from a cDNA library of carrot somatic embryos, since carrot is a better model plant for preparing large quantities of somatic embryos at the same developmental stage. The predicted amino acid sequence of C-LEC1 is similar to that of LEC1 and contains regions that are conserved in the heme-activated protein 3 (HAP3) subunit of plants, animals and microorganisms. C-LEC1 expression was detected in embryogenic cells, somatic embryos, and developing seeds. In situ hybridization analysis revealed C-LEC1 expression in the peripheral region of the embryos but not in the endosperm. Expression of C-LEC1 driven by Arabidopsis LEC1 promoter was able to complement the defects of the Arabidopsis lec1-1 mutant. These results suggest that C-LEC1 is a functional homolog of Arabidopsis LEC1, an important regulator of zygotic and somatic embryo development.
